Aplicación

El acetato de etilo (grado ACS) se puede utilizar como disolvente en la síntesis de 6-O-acetil glucósidos mediante acetilación selectiva de carbohidratos en presencia de una cantidad catalítica de ácido sulfúrico. Los 6-O-acetil glucósido derivados son aplicables como precursores para la síntesis de oligosacáridos complejos.[1]

  1. How is shipping temperature determined? And how is it related to the product storage temperature?

    1 answer
    1. Products may be shipped at a different temperature than the recommended long-term storage temperature. If the product quality is sensitive to short-term exposure to conditions other than the recommended long-term storage, it will be shipped on wet or dry-ice. If the product quality is NOT affected by short-term exposure to conditions other than the recommended long-term storage, it will be shipped at ambient temperature. As shipping routes are configured for minimum transit times, shipping at ambient temperature helps control shipping costs for our customers.   3. What methods or procedures should be followed to perform the measurements of 'Residue on Evaporation' and 'Titratable Acid', as outlined in the COA for product 319902?

    1 answer
    1. For an MQ 200 quality level product, it is typically not possible to share test methods. However, in the case of an ACS grade product, one can refer directly to the available ACS monograph.
      The monograph provides specific instructions for conducting the residue on evaporation test, which involves evaporating 40.0 g (45.0 mL) of the sample to dryness in a tared, preconditioned dish on a hot plate (~100 °C). Subsequently, the residue is dried at 105 °C for a duration of 30 minutes.
      Regarding the titratable acid test, the monograph advises adding 0.10 mL of phenolphthalein indicator solution to 10 mL of ethyl alcohol and neutralizing it with 0.01 N sodium hydroxide. Then, 9.0 g (10.0 mL) of the sample should be added, gently mixed, and titrated with 0.01 N sodium hydroxide until the pink color persists for 15 seconds. The requirement is that the usage of sodium hydroxide should not exceed 0.80 mL.
